路由器微调¶
在本 Notebook 中,我们实验了对 LLM 驱动的路由器进行微调。我们尝试了几种不同的方法,使用查询 + 真实“选择”作为训练信号。
- 微调嵌入
- 微调跨编码器
我们的数据集将使用不同城市的维基百科文章。
我们将为每种微调方法生成一个合成数据集。我们还将进行一些基本评估。

运行评估¶
在本节中,我们将评估微调后的嵌入模型与基础模型在选择正确选项方面的质量差异。
我们将两者都插入到我们的 `EmbeddingSelector` 抽象中。
我们还与使用 GPT-4 的基础 `LLMSingleSelector` 进行比较。

基础嵌入模型 | GPT-3.5 | 微调嵌入模型 | |
---|---|---|---|
匹配率 | 0.128492 | 0.659218 | 0.994413 |
插入到路由器中¶
我们将其作为 `EmbeddingSelector` 插入到我们的 `RouterQueryEngine` 中(默认情况下,我们的路由器查询引擎中使用的是 `LLMSingleSelector`)。
